عَنْ مَحْمُودِ بْنِ لَبِيدٍ أَخِي بَنِي عَبْدِ الْأَشْهَلِ عَنْ سَلَمَةَ بْنِ سَلَامَةَ بْنِ وَقْشٍ وَكَانَ مِنْ أَصْحَابِ بَدْرٍ رَضِيَ اللَّهُ عَنْهُ قَالَ كَانَ لَنَا جَارٌ مِنْ يَهُودَ فِي بَنِي عَبْدِ الْأَشْهَلِ قَالَ فَخَرَجَ عَلَيْنَا يَوْمًا مِنْ بَيْتِهِ قَبْلَ مَبْعَثِ النَّبِيِّ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َآلِهِ وَسَلَّمَ بِيَسِيرٍ فَوَقَفَ عَلَى مَجْلِسِ عَبْدِ الْأَشْهَلِ قَالَ سَلَمَةُ وَأَنَا يَوْمَئِذٍ أَحْدَثُ مَنْ فِيهِ سِنًّا عَلَيَّ بُرْدَةٌ مُضْطَجِعًا فِيهَا بِفِنَاءِ أَهْلِي فَذَكَرَ الْبَعْثَ وَالْقِيَامَةَ وَالْحِسَابَ وَالْمِيزَانَ وَالْجَنَّةَ وَالنَّارَ فَقَالَ ذَلِكَ لِقَوْمٍ أَهْلِ شِرْكٍ أَصْحَابِ أَوْثَانٍ لَا يَرَوْنَ أَنَّ بَعْثًا كَائِنٌ بَعْدَ الْمَوْتِ فَقَالُوا لَهُ وَيْحَكَ يَا فُلَانُ تَرَى هَذَا كَائِنًا إِنَّ النَّاسَ يُبْعَثُونَ بَعْدَ مَوْتِهِمْ إِلَى دَارٍ فِيهَا جَنَّةٌ وَنَارٌ يُجْزَوْنَ فِيهَا بِأَعْمَالِهِمْ قَالَ نَعَمْ وَالَّذِي يُحْلَفُ بِهِ لَوَدَّ أَنَّ لَهُ بِحَظِّهِ مِنْ تِلْكَ النَّارِ أَعْظَمَ تَنُّورٍ فِي الدُّنْيَا يُحَمُّونَهُ ثُمَّ يُدْخِلُونَهُ إِيَّاهُ فَيُطْبَقُ بِهِ عَلَيْهِ وَأَنْ يَنْجُوَ مِنْ تِلْكَ النَّارِ غَدًا قَالُوا لَهُ وَيْحَكَ وَمَا آيَةُ ذَلِكَ قَالَ نَبِيٌّ يُبْعَثُ مِنْ نَحْوِ هَذِهِ الْبِلَادِ وَأَشَارَ بِيَدِهِ نَحْوَ مَكَّةَ وَالْيَمَنِ قَالُوا وَمَتَى تَرَاهُ قَالَ فَنَظَرَ إِلَيَّ وَأَنَا مِنْ أَحْدَثِهِمْ سِنًّا فَقَالَ إِنْ يَسْتَنْفِدْ هَذَا الْغُلَامُ عُمُرَهُ يُدْرِكْهُ قَالَ سَلَمَةُ فَوَاللَّهِ مَا ذَهَبَ اللَّيْلُ وَالنَّهَارُ حَتَّى بَعَثَ اللَّهُ تَعَالَى رَسُولَهُ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َآلِهِ وَسَلَّمَ وَهُوَ حَيٌّ بَيْنَ أَظْهُرِنَا فَآمَنَّا بِهِ وَكَفَرَ بِهِ بَغْيًا وَحَسَدًا فَقُلْنَا وَيْلَكَ يَا فُلَانُ أَلَسْتَ بِالَّذِي قُلْتَ لَنَا فِيهِ مَا قُلْتَ قَالَ بَلَى وَلَيْسَ بِهِ
Sayyiduna Mahmood bin Lubaid from the tribe of Banu Abdul-Ashhal narrates from Salamah bin Salamah bin Waqsh, who was among the Companions of Badr. He says that a Jew from the tribe of Banu Abdul-Ashhal was our neighbor. A few days before the advent of the Prophet Muhammad (peace and blessings be upon him), one day he came out of his house and stood in a gathering of the tribe of Abdul-Ashhal. Salamah says: I was the youngest present there that day. I was lying in front of my house, wrapped in a sheet. That Jew mentioned resurrection after death, the Day of Judgment, reckoning, the scale, and Paradise and Hell. He spoke of these things before people who were polytheists and idol worshippers, who did not believe in resurrection after death. They said to him: "What is this? Do you also say that this will happen, and people will be raised in another world after death, where there will be Paradise and Hell, and people will be rewarded for their deeds?" He said: "Yes, by the One by whom oaths are sworn! I would even prefer that there be a great furnace of fire in this world, and people enter it, and then it is closed over them, and I am saved from the fire of Hell tomorrow." The people said to him: "Woe to you, what is its sign?" He pointed towards Makkah and Yemen and said: "A Prophet will be sent from those regions." The people asked him: "When will we be able to see him?" He looked at me—I was the youngest among them—and said: "If this boy lives, he will see him before his life ends." Salamah (may Allah be pleased with him) says: "By Allah! Only a few days and nights had passed when Allah sent His Messenger (peace and blessings be upon him), and he was alive among us. So we believed in him, but that Jew disbelieved in him out of hatred and envy. We said to him: 'O so-and-so! Woe to you! Are you not the one who told us about this Prophet and informed us?' He said: 'Yes, of course, but this is not that Prophet.'"
Hadith Reference الفتح الربانی / أهم أحداث السنة الأولى للهجرة / 10679
Hadith Grading محدثین: صحیح
Hadith Takhrij «اسناده حسن، أخرجه الطبراني في المعجم الكبير : 6327، والحاكم: 3/ 417 ، (انظر مسند أحمد ترقيم الرسالة: 15841 ترقیم بيت الأفكار الدولية: 15935»
